Capybaras
Hydrochoerus Hydrochaeris.Largest living rodent on the planet. Closely related to chinchillas and guinea pigs but a hell of a lot bigger. There are incidences of them being domesticated and kept as pets (in fact I think one was reported in the Times not so long ago). According to Wikipedia, they can grow to around 1m30 and weigh around 65kg. That's one hefty guinea pig.
